Hugo Boss BOSS The Scent
This spicy, powerful and full-bodied fragrance with notes of ginger and leather is the perfect addition to his aftershave collection.  You can find my full review here and find it here at Boots and John Lewis.




VIKTOR & ROLF Spicebomb
This grenade shaped flanker is a powerful explosion of spicy grapefruit, chilli, leather, pink pepper and cinnamon which will be ideal for his big nights out.  You can find it here at Boots and John Lewis.

Paco Rabanne 1 Million Cologne No Father’s Day would be complete without an aftershave. It is a staple and a safe bet. But will he like it? The 1 Million Cologne is an excellent gift; it is a warm and heady fragrance with excellent longevity (I could still smell it the next day!) It has rich aromatic notes of cardamom, mandarin, cinnamon, juniper berries, leather, tonka beans and patchouli.
